Volume 9, Book 85, Number 75:
Narrated Qais:
I heard Sa’id bin Zaid saying, “I have seen myself tied and forced by ‘Umar to leave Islam (Before
‘Umar himself embraced Islam). And if the mountain of Uhud were to collapse for the evil which you
people had done to ‘Uthman, then Uhud would have the right to do so.” (See Hadith No. 202, Vol. 5)
Volume 9, Book 85, Number 74:
Narrated Anas:
Allah’s Apostle said, “Whoever possesses the (following) three qualities will have the sweetness of
faith (1): The one to whom Allah and His Apostle becomes dearer than anything else; (2) Who loves a
person and he loves him only for Allah’s Sake; (3) who hates to revert to atheism (disbelief) as he
hates to be thrown into the Fire.”
Volume 9, Book 85, Number 73:
Narrated Abi Huraira:
The Prophet used to invoke Allah in his prayer, “O Allah! Save ‘Aiyash bin Abi Rabi’a and Salama
bin Hisham and Al-Walid bin Al-Walid; O Allah! Save the weak among the believers; O Allah! Be
hard upon the tribe of Mudar and inflict years (of famine) upon them like the (famine) years of
Joseph.”
Volume 9, Book 84, Number 72:
Narrated:
Abu ‘Abdur-Rahman and Hibban bin ‘Atiyya had a dispute. Abu ‘Abdur-Rahman said to Hibban,
“You know what made your companions (i.e. Ali) dare to shed blood.” Hibban said, “Come on! What
is that?” ‘Abdur-Rahman said, “Something I heard him saying.” The other said, “What was it?” ‘Abdur –
Rahman said, “‘Ali said, Allah’s Apostle sent for me, Az-Zubair and Abu Marthad, and all of us were
cavalry men, and said, ‘Proceed to Raudat-Hajj (Abu Salama said that Abu ‘Awana called it like this,
i.e., Hajj where there is a woman carrying a letter from Hatib bin Abi Balta’a to the pagans (of
Mecca). So bring that letter to me.’ So we proceeded riding on our horses till we overtook her at the
same place of which Allah’s Apostle had told us. She was traveling on her camel. In that letter Hatib
had written to the Meccans about the proposed attached of Allah’s Apostle against them. We asked
her, “Where is the letter which is with you?’ She replied, ‘I haven’t got any letter.’ So we made her
camel kneel down and searched her luggage, but we did not find anything. My two companions said,
‘We do not think that she has got a letter.’ I said, ‘We know that Allah’s Apostle has not told a lie.'”
Then ‘Ali took an oath saying, “By Him by Whom one should swear! You shall either bring out the
letter or we shall strip off your clothes.” She then stretched out her hand for her girdle (round her
waist) and brought out the paper (letter). They took the letter to Allah’s Apostle. ‘Umar said, “O Allah’s
Apostle! (Hatib) has betrayed Allah, His Apostle and the believers; let me chop off his neck!” Allah’s
Apostle said, “O Hatib! What obliged you to do what you have done?” Hatib replied, “O Allah’s
Apostle! Why (for what reason) should I not believe in Allah and His Apostle? But I intended to do
the (Mecca) people a favor by virtue of which my family and property may be protected as there is
none of your companions but has some of his people (relatives) whom Allah urges to protect his
family and property.” The Prophet said, “He has said the truth; therefore, do not say anything to him
except good.” ‘Umar again said, “O Allah’s Apostle! He has betrayed Allah, His Apostle and the believ –
ers; let me chop his neck off!” The Prophet said, “Isn’t he from those who fought the battle of Badr?
And what do you know, Allah might have looked at them (Badr warriors) and said (to them), ‘Do
what you like, for I have granted you Paradise?’ ” On that, ‘Umar’s eyes became flooded with tears
and he said, “Allah and His Apostle know best.”

Volume 9, Book 84, Number 70:
Narrated ‘Abdullah:
When the Verse:–‘Those who believe and did not confuse their belief with wrong (worshipping
others besides Allah).’ (6.82) was revealed, it was hard on the companions of the Prophet and they
said, “Who among us has not wronged (oppressed) himself?” Allah’s Apostle said, “The meaning of
the Verse is not as you think, but it is as Luqman said to his son, ‘O my son! Join not in worship oth –
ers with Allah, Verily! Joining others in worship with Allah is a great wrong indeed.'” (31.13)
Volume 9, Book 84, Number 69:
Narrated Abu Huraira:
Allah’s Apostle said, “The Hour will not be established till two (huge) groups fight against each
other, their claim being one and the same.”

Volume 9, Book 84, Number 68:
Narrated Yusair bin ‘Amr:
I asked Sahl bin Hunaif, “Did you hear the Prophet saying anything about Al-Khawarij?” He said, “I
heard him saying while pointing his hand towards Iraq. “There will appear in it (i.e, Iraq) some
people who will recite the Quran but it will not go beyond their throats, and they will go out from
(leave) Islam as an arrow darts through the game’s body.’ “
